Preparing the device for work and setting up Wi-Fi

Before you start downloading video, you need to make sure that your Xiaomi DVR is properly configured and ready to transfer data. The first step is to install a microSD memory card, preferably with a speed class of U1 or higher, to ensure stable recording in high resolution. Without a properly formatted drive, the device may not create new files or work with errors.

The next step is to activate the Wi-Fi hotspot on the recorder itself, which usually requires you to press the control button on the device body for a short time, or use a voice command if the model supports control, and on the screen of the gadget or through audio signals, you will receive information about the network name and password to connect.

  • πŸ“± Install the official Mijia app or 70mai (depending on your device model from Google Play or App Store.
  • πŸ”Œ Charge the device or connect it to the vehicle’s on-board network for stable operation during data transfer.
  • πŸ“Ά Make sure that the Bluetooth and geolocation modules are enabled on the smartphone, as they are necessary for primary pairing.

It's important to understand that when you connect to a Wi-Fi recorder, your phone may temporarily lose access to the Internet over a mobile network. This is normal behavior, as priority is given to a local connection to the device. Some phone models may request confirmation to use the network without access to the Internet - be sure to agree with this.

⚠️ Note: Do not turn off the registrar power while actively recording or formatting the memory card, as this may damage the file system and lose recent records.

Using a mobile application to upload files

The most convenient way to get a video is to use proprietary software. Once you connect your smartphone to the registrar's Wi-Fi network, open the app and select your device from the list. The program interface allows you to stream live video and access the archive of records.

In the Album or Records section, you'll see a list of available files, sorted by date and time. The app automatically splits the video into regular records and files saved at the time of the event (G-sensor). To download, select the desired video and click the download button, after which the file is saved to the phone gallery.

Wi-Fi data rates can vary depending on the router model inside the recorder and the distance to the smartphone, which is typically 1 to 3 MB/s, which allows you to download approximately 60-180 megabytes of data per minute. For short videos that are 1-3 minutes long, this takes seconds.

When downloading long video fragments, try to keep the smartphone still next to the recorder, as the movement can cause a connection to break and the need to restart the process.

Direct connection of the memory card to the computer

If you need to copy a lot of data or video files weigh a few gigabytes, the wireless method may be too slow, and the most effective solution is to extract the microSD card and connect it to your PC via a card reader, which is a method that provides maximum copy speed.

Retrieving the card usually requires pressing it in the slot before the characteristic click, after which it pops out.Be careful not to touch metal contacts with your fingers so as not to damage them with static electricity or grease.Put the card into the adapter and connect it to the device. USB-port.

The computer will identify a new removable device. Open it through My Computer and find a folder called DCIM or Movie. Inside it will be folders with dates or record types (Normal, Event, Parking). Just copy the files you want to see to your hard drive.

Once you have completed the copy, be sure to safely extract the device through the operating system before physically disabling the card, ensuring that all write buffers are cleaned and the file is not corrupted.

Working with cyclic recording and protected files

One of the key features of Xiaomi recorders is cyclic recording: when the card memory is filled, the device automatically overwrites the oldest files with new ones, but files marked as an β€œevent” (for example, during a sharp braking or impact) are protected from deletion.

To download this kind of secure video, the app needs to go to the appropriate tab, often indicated by the red icon or the word β€œEvent”, and these files will not be deleted during cyclical overwriting until the memory card is fully filled even with them.

What happens when a protected section is overflowed?
If the protected file partition (Event) gets crowded, the registrar starts overwriting the oldest protected files, ignoring their security status, so it is important to manually clean this partition periodically.

The user can manually block the current video by pressing the appropriate button on the case or in the application while driving, which will turn the regular video into a protected one, keeping it from erasing, and it is recommended to do this immediately after the incident to ensure that the evidence is safe.

  • πŸ”’ Secured files are stored in a separate directory on a memory card.
  • πŸ”„ Cyclical recording does not affect files with the β€œEvent” tag until their partition is fully filled.
  • πŸ“Ή The duration of one video is usually 1, 3 or 5 minutes depending on the settings.

Solving Connection and File Visibility Problems

Quite often, users are faced with a situation where the phone sees the registrar, but can not download the list of videos or the process freezes at the initial stage. First of all, check whether the file name is too long or the path to it - some older versions of Android do not handle long titles well.

The file system format can also be a problem. Xiaomi registrars usually format cards in FAT32 or exFAT. If you format a card on your computer in NTFS, the device may not work correctly. Do formatting through the registrar's menu or through the application.

⚠️ Note: If the app crashes constantly when trying to open the gallery, try clearing the app cache in the settings Android/iOS or reinstall it.

In some cases, rebooting the recorder itself helps: turn off the power, remove the memory card, wipe the contacts with dry cloth and paste back in. After turning on, wait 30-60 seconds before the system is fully loaded before trying to connect over Wi-Fi.

Convert and playback video on other devices

Once you have managed to download video from Xiaomi’s registrar to your computer or phone, you may find that the file is not played by a standard player, which is due to the use of an H.264 or H.265 codec and an MP4 container, which require certain characteristics for smooth playback in 2K or 4K resolution.

For viewing and editing, it is best to use universal players such as VLC Media Player or MPC-HC. They contain built-in codecs and are able to play almost any video stream without additional conversion. If you need to send a video via a messenger, it will have to be compressed.

Conversion may be required if you want to upload a video to a social network with tight file size limits. Use programs like HandBrake or online converters, choosing a "Fast 1080p30" profile for optimal quality and size balance.

πŸ’‘

Use the H.264 codec for maximum compatibility with any device, even if your logger writes in H.265.

Remember that the original recorder video contains important metadata: date, time, speed and GPS coordinates (if the module is built in).

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Why is the phone not connected to the Wi-Fi recorder?
The most common problem is that the phone is trying to use mobile internet instead of the registrar's Wi-Fi network. Make sure the Wi-Fi settings select "Use this network" even without access to the Internet. Also check if the password is incorrect (the standard one is often indicated on the sticker).
Can I download the video while the registrar writes?
Yes, most Xiaomi models allow you to download archive records during ongoing recording. However, the transfer speed may slow down, and in rare cases, the recording may be interrupted if the device's processor can not cope with the load.
Where are the downloaded videos on the iPhone stored?
When using the Mijia or 70mai app on iOS, videos are usually saved to the Video or Recent album inside the standard Photos app, sometimes requiring the app to be allowed to access the library for the first time.
How to recover deleted video from the recorder?
If you deleted a file through an application or formatted a map, you can only recover data using special PC programs such as Recuva or PhotoRec. The chance of success is high if no new data has been written to the card since the deletion.
